Thales

Thales Group, a global leader in advanced technology solutions, is headquartered in France and operates extensively across Europe, Asia, and North America. Founded in 2000, following the merger of several companies, Thales has established itself as a key player in the aerospace, defence, security, and transportation sectors. The company is renowned for its innovative products and services, including secure communications, digital identity solutions, and advanced avionics systems. Thales's commitment to cutting-edge technology and cybersecurity sets it apart in a competitive market. With a strong market position, Thales has achieved significant milestones, including numerous contracts with government and commercial entities worldwide, reinforcing its reputation as a trusted partner in critical infrastructure and security solutions.

Thales's reported carbon emissions

Thales, headquartered in France, currently does not provide specific carbon emissions data for recent years, as no emissions figures are available. Consequently, there are no documented reduction targets or initiatives outlined in their climate commitments. Without concrete data or defined goals, it is challenging to assess their current impact on climate change or their strategic approach to reducing carbon emissions. As a leader in the technology and defence sectors, Thales's climate commitments may align with industry standards, but further information would be necessary to evaluate their specific actions and targets in addressing carbon emissions.
